如何使用pandas将不同年份的数据进行分列,现在有专门一列是年份的数据,我需要将其变成行字段
时间: 2024-02-23 07:00:37 浏览: 60
Pandas实现一列数据分隔为两列
你可以使用 Pandas 中的 `pivot` 函数来实现将年份数据转换为行字段。具体操作如下:
假设你有一个名为 `df` 的 Pandas DataFrame,其中包含一个名为 `Year` 的列,代表年份数据,还有其他列代表其他数据。你可以按照以下代码来将年份数据转换为行字段:
```
new_df = df.pivot(index='其他行字段', columns='Year', values='其他数据')
```
其中,`其他行字段` 代表你想要保留的其他行字段,`其他数据` 代表你想要保留的其他数据列。`new_df` 就是转换后的 DataFrame。你可以将实际的列名替换为你的实际列名。
阅读全文